The National Monuments Service's description
In undulating pasture, on a SE-facing slope, overlooking fen to the E. A sub-oval area (dims. c. 42m NNW-SSE; c. 35m ENE-WSW) defined by scarp (Wth 1.4m; H 0.45m), fosse (overall Wth 4.65m; basal Wth 1.5m; D 0.35m) and external bank (overall Wth 5.95m; Wth at top 2m; int. H 0.35m; ext. H 1.75m) only clearly visible at E. Other very small areas are visible where only scarp is seen at S and NE. Otherwise exterior of bank is obscured by substantial piles of organic debris all around. The interior is completely overgrown with thorn and briar thickets and is inaccessible. A field boundary radiates from the E and a field boundary to the NW is gone.
